Introducing New Bag Collections for Spring 2011
Continuing our reputation for design innovation, we’re pleased to unveil new bag collections for Spring 2011. Featuring bold new materials and striking new color combinations, these collections build on some of our most popular designs, while maintaining the exceptional comfort, durability, and device-driven features that Incase bags are renowned for.
Alloy Collection
The new Alloy Collection recasts our most iconic packs, bags and sleeves in a highly textured fabric with a stunning matte metallic finish. Inspired by bold advances in technology and engineering, the collection’s dynamic surfaces exhibit a unique tactile and visual appeal.
Nylon Collection
Clean lines and all-purpose functionality are distinct characteristics of the Nylon Collection. Now available in three new color ranges featuring ebony with green pop, taupe with hints of blue, and deep violet with electric lime accents, the Nylon Collection offers a complete selection of bags for daily use.
Courier Collection
Enhanced durability and performance make the new Courier Collection a necessity for navigating the urban landscape. Pairing the best aspects of conventional messenger bags with a refined industrial design aesthetic and device-driven functional features, the Courier Collection provides superior durability, waterproofing and ease-of-use that professional couriers can rely on.
New for Spring, the Courier Collection will soon be available in grayed jade with contrasting orange details and traditional black on black.
The Alloy and Nylon Collections are available today in our webstore and select retailers worldwide. Expect the Courier Collection to drop early March 2011.
